iwlwifi: mvm: support dqa-mode agg on non-shared queue

In non-shared queues, DQA requires re-configuring existing
queues to become aggregated rather than allocating a new
one. It also requires "un-aggregating" an existing queue
when aggregations are turned off.

Support this requirement for non-shared queues.

+/*
+ * enum iwl_mvm_queue_status - queue status
+ * @IWL_MVM_QUEUE_FREE: the queue is not allocated nor reserved
+ *	Basically, this means that this queue can be used for any purpose
+ * @IWL_MVM_QUEUE_RESERVED: queue is reserved but not yet in use
+ *	This is the state of a queue that has been dedicated for some RATID
+ *	(agg'd or not), but that hasn't yet gone through the actual enablement
+ *	of iwl_mvm_enable_txq(), and therefore no traffic can go through it yet.
+ *	Note that in this state there is no requirement to already know what TID
+ *	should be used with this queue, it is just marked as a queue that will
+ *	be used, and shouldn't be allocated to anyone else.
+ * @IWL_MVM_QUEUE_READY: queue is ready to be used
+ *	This is the state of a queue that has been fully configured (including
+ *	SCD pointers, etc), has a specific RA/TID assigned to it, and can be
+ *	used to send traffic.
+ */
+enum iwl_mvm_queue_status {
+	IWL_MVM_QUEUE_FREE,
+	IWL_MVM_QUEUE_RESERVED,
+	IWL_MVM_QUEUE_READY,
+};
